I've said for awhile that Barkley's going to be a solid QB in this league but he will absolutely have to go to a WCO. Well Reid's his guy then.

On the other hand, Reid has generally favored a more aggressive WCO; it uses the hitches, outs, etc... to utilize all 4 intermediate zones, but he also likes to push the ball upfield to keep defenders honest.

To my eyes, he's the most aggressive of the WCO practitioners. Can Barkley really thrive if Reid is trying to push the ball downfield? Oh, and can we really use 1.1 on a guy who's shoulder may/may not be sound?

Barkley is a sensible option, but certainly not my favorite.
